In a groundbreaking move to make quality dental care accessible to all Ghanaians, German Ozone Medical Centre (GOMC) has announced the launch of Ghana’s most affordable dental implant service.
The centre has slashed the cost from $2500 to just $1200.
This initiative, launched on World Oral Health Day, is set to transform the landscape of dental healthcare in Ghana by ensuring that more people can restore their smiles without financial strain.
Dental implants, widely recognized as the gold standard for replacing missing teeth, have long been considered too expensive for the average Ghanaian. With costs typically ranging between $2500 to $5000 per implant, many people are forced to settle for less effective alternatives or avoid treatment altogether.
However, German Ozone Medical Centre is rewriting this narrative. By reducing the cost to $1200, GOMC is ensuring that high-quality, long-lasting, and natural-looking dental implants are no longer a luxury but an affordable necessity.

Why Choose Dental Implants?
Unlike dentures or bridges, dental implants provide a permanent solution to missing teeth, offering:
- Improved Speech & Comfort: Speak and eat naturally without discomfort.
- Long-Lasting Durability: With proper care, implants can last a lifetime.
- A Confidence Boost: Enjoy a complete, natural-looking smile.
- Better Oral Health: Prevent bone loss and maintain facial structure.
